The idea of celebrating Giving Tuesday on the first Tuesday after Thanksgiving originated in the United States in 2012. Millions of people around the world annually hold various events for the benefit of charitable organizations and disseminate this information on social networks with the call to do good for those who need it most.
Ukraine joined the global Giving Tuesday movement in 2018 to become the 154th country member of the global charitable community. On December 3, 2019, the country celebrates this day for the second time. Giving Tuesday unites the country around good deeds and proves once again that everyone can give joy.
